// is-network-error vendored to avoid import issues
// Source: https://github.com/sindresorhus/is-network-error
const objectToString = Object.prototype.toString;
const isError = (value) => objectToString.call(value) === "[object Error]";
const errorMessages = new Set([
"network error", // Chrome
"Failed to fetch", // Chrome
"NetworkError when attempting to fetch resource.", // Firefox
"The Internet connection appears to be offline.", // Safari 16
"Network request failed", // `cross-fetch`
"fetch failed", // Undici (Node.js)
"terminated", // Undici (Node.js)
" A network error occurred.", // Bun (WebKit)
"Network connection lost", // Cloudflare Workers (fetch)
]);
export default function isNetworkError(error) {
const isValid = error &&
isError(error) &&
error.name === "TypeError" &&
typeof error.message === "string";
if (!isValid) {
return false;
}
const { message, stack } = error;
// Safari 17+ has generic message but no stack for network errors
if (message === "Load failed") {
return (stack === undefined ||
// Sentry adds its own stack trace to the fetch error, so also check for that
"__sentry_captured__" in error);
}
// Deno network errors start with specific text
if (message.startsWith("error sending request for url")) {
return true;
}
// Standard network error messages
return errorMessages.has(message);
}
